Elizabeth Field
Welcome to Elizabeth Field, a charming airport located on Fishers Island in Suffolk County, New York. This public-use airport, with the IATA code FID, serves as a gateway for travelers seeking a unique experience. Owned by the Town of Southold, Elizabeth Field is classified as a general aviation airport. The airfield has a rich history, having seen military use during World War II as part of Fort H. G. Wright. Number of Passengers and Flights
In recent years, Elizabeth Field Airport has seen a steady flow of air traffic. For the 12-month period ending September 27, 2007, the airport recorded approximately 2,125 aircraft operations, averaging about 177 operations per month. This included a mix of air taxi services, general aviation flights, and a small percentage of military operations. While the numbers may seem modest compared to larger airports, they reflect the airport's role in facilitating travel to and from the island.
